Meme soundboards have become a staple of internet culture, transforming how we communicate, entertain, and even educate. In 2025, these digital tools are more popular than ever, thanks to their integration with social platforms, streaming services, and even remote work environments. A meme soundboard is a digital application or device that allows users to play popular meme sounds and audio clips at the press of a button, making it perfect for injecting humor, emphasizing a point, or simply having fun in online interactions.

Yet another week, yet another headline-making crypto hack, and once again, all things point to the Lazarus Group. The infamous hacking group linked to North Korea is back in 2025 with a renewed set of attacks targeting decentralized finance protocols, centralized exchanges, and even unsuspecting cryptocurrency developers. Although it has been targeted by international attention, sanctions, and the increased scrutiny of cybersecurity over the years, the group still manages to remain frighteningly successful.
